Building Demolition Service in Essex County, NJ
Building demolition services involve the careful tearing down of structures such as homes, garages, sheds, or other buildings on residential properties. These projects often require removing existing structures to make way for new construction, renovations, or property improvements. Property owners typically seek this service to safely and efficiently clear unwanted or outdated buildings, ensuring the site is prepared for future development or landscaping. It is important for homeowners to understand the scope of demolition work, including site cleanup and debris removal, as well as any necessary permits or regulations that may apply in Essex County, NJ and surrounding areas.
Before requesting building demolition services, property owners should consider the size and type of the structure, as well as the potential impact on neighboring properties. Clarifying the extent of demolition needed-whether partial or complete-helps in planning the project effectively. Additionally, understanding the process for obtaining any required permits and knowing what preparations are needed on the property can help ensure a smooth and compliant demolition. Proper planning and clear communication about project goals are essential for a successful demolition process.

Common Building Demolition Service Jobs
Residential demolitions - safely tearing down outdated or unwanted structures on private property.
Commercial building removal - clearing commercial spaces for renovations or new development projects.
Garage and shed demolition - removing small structures to improve yard space or prepare for landscaping.
Interior demolition - stripping out interior walls, flooring, or fixtures for remodeling purposes.
Partial demolition - removing specific sections of a building to facilitate upgrades or repairs.
Structural demolition - dismantling entire buildings when they are no longer suitable for use or renovation.
Building Demolition Service Questions
What types of structures can be demolished? Building demolition services typically handle residential homes, garages, sheds, and small commercial structures.
Is a building demolition safe for neighboring properties? Proper planning and safety measures are essential to minimize impact on surrounding properties during demolition.
What should property owners know before starting a demolition? It is important to obtain necessary permits and ensure utilities are disconnected before demolition begins.
Can demolition services clear out debris afterward? Yes, most demolition providers include debris removal as part of their services to leave the site ready for future use.
